<p><strong>Starting from London</strong></p>
<p><strong>The most well-to-do as well as most lineal way to arrive at Zanzibar from London is to take off via Dar es Salaam, on Tanzania&#8217;s coast. British Airways flights to Dar flee London Heathrow all Monday, Wednesday in addition to Saturday evening, getting in  Dar the following morning.</strong></p>
<p>And then connections join through from Dar to Stone Town Airport on Zanzibar. These are absolutely regular flights, generally every hour or two; the first flight departs Dar around 7:30 in the break of day, the final flight departs at 5:45 in the evening; flight time is about 20 minutes.</p>
<p>Make an observation that the first Zanzibar/Dar flight on Wednesdays, Fridays as well as Sundays leaves at 06:45, and is arranged to link with the morning BA flights from Dar to London Heathrow. This is normally a good link which works exceptionally well.</p>
<p>From Stone Town, various lodges may well be reached by road transfer, even though Chumbe Island Lodge along with Mnemba Island Lodge require additionally boat transport.<a href="http://www.zanzibarholidays.org/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/plane.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-134" title="plane" src="http://www.zanzibarholidays.org/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/plane.jpg" alt="" width="250" height="179" /></a></p>
<p>As an alternative, you are able to fly to Zanzibar from many other places in Tanzania, including Arusha (daily; 12:15-13:45pm), Manyara (daily; 11:50-13:45pm), Ruaha (daily; via Dar), the Selous (daily; via Dar), and Mafia Island (daily; via Dar). Our flights as well serves a couple of landing strips in the Serengeti National Park directly, including the strips close to Grumeti River Camp, Klein&#8217;s Camp along with Lobo Wildlife Lodge in the Serengeti Migration Area. More or less of these flights will check at Dar, although quick connections entail that they are advantageous if you want to add a Zanzibar beach vacation to your hunting expedition in Tanzania.</p>

<p>Starting from the USA</p>
<p>Flying from the United States of America, your have two assorted alternatives for the flight preparations:</p>
<p>1) You prepare your flights USA -&gt; London and London -&gt; USA for yourself.<br />
Specialist Africa sets the London -&gt; your Zanzibar lodge as well as your Zanzibar lodge -&gt; London flights along with transfers for you.</p>
<p>We have suitable rates on the flights to Africa, which permits us to use low add-on charges for internal flights within Africa – connected to your international flight ticket. On the other hand, you ought to be certain that you have more than enough connecting time between planes at London Heathrow Airport.</p>
<p>2) You set up your own flights USA -&gt; Tanzania and Tanzania -&gt; USA, either via the UK or on a different route, furthermore inform us of the flight times, and of your flight carriers.<br />
Professional Africa prepares your travels in Tanzania for you, not to mention any smaller flights, in addition to road along with boat transfers within the Zanzibar Archipelago.</p>
<p>Whenever you opt to organise your own worldwide flights, then ideally we opt you to book any connecting flights simultaneously. It&#8217;s most excellent to do this with the same agency from whom you purchased your intercontinental flight tickets. This way, should one among your &#8216;connecting&#8217; flights be bogged down or retracted, the airlines involved will take accountability for getting you to your destination as soon as possible.</p>

<p>NEAREST INTERNATIONAL AIRPORTS TO NORTHERN TANZANIA:</p>
<p>Kilimanjaro International Airport (JRO):</p>
<p>Flights which operate are KLM Royal Dutch Airline, Ethiopian Airline and Air Tanzania.<br />
Transfer time: Kilimanjaro Airport to Arusha town: An approximate 1 hour drive.<br />
Airport transfer cost: From US$85 per vehicle &#8211; sits up to six people.</p>
<p>Jomo Kenyatta International Airport (JKIA) &#8211; Nairobi</p>
<p>Flights operating are British Airways, Sabena, KLM Royal Dutch Airline, Ethiopian Airline, Emirates Airline, Gulf Air, Swiss Air, Kenya Airways, Air Tanzania, Regional Air and South African Airways.</p>
<p>Transfer time:<br />
Airport to Nairobi City &#8211; Approximate 20minutes.<br />
Airport to Arusha town &#8211; By road: Approximate 4 and a half hours drive with 30minutes clearance at the Namanga Border (Kenya / Tanzania Border)</p>
<p>Airport Transfer Costs:<br />
Private Transfer from the Airport to Nairobi City: From US$50 per vehicle (sits up to 6 people).<br />
Private Transfer Nairobi to Arusha Town: From US$500 per vehicle -sits up to 6 people. Express Shuttle Bus from Nairobi to Arusha &#8211; Two departures daily, at 08h00 and 14h00. Cost: US$30 per person</p>
<p>Dar-es-Salaam International Airport (DAR):</p>
<p>Flights operating are British Airways, KLM Royal Dutch Airline, Ethiopian Airline, Emirates Airline, Gulf Air, Swiss Air, Kenya Airways, Air Tanzania and South African Airways.</p>
<p>Transfer time:<br />
Airport to Dar es Salaam City &#8211; An approximate 30 minutes drive.<br />
Airport to Harbour (Sea port for Hydrofoil Boats to Zanzibar) &#8211; approximate 30minutes drive.<br />
Dar es Salaam to Arusha by road takes 8 to 9 hours with the Luxury Express Tourist Bus.<br />
Dar es Salaam to Zanzibar with a Hydrofoil Boat takes approximate 90minutes.</p>

<p>Zanzibar International Airport (ZNZ):</p>
<p>Flights which operate, are Ethiopian Airline, Gulf Air, Kenya Airways, Air Tanzania, Zan Air, Precision Air, Eagle Air and Coastal Air.</p>
<p>Transfer time:<br />
Airport to Zanzibar Stone town or Harbour (Sea port for Pemba or Dar es Salaam Hydrofoils) &#8211; approximate 20minutes drive.<br />
Airport to Beach Resort &#8211; Approximate 1 hour.<br />
Zanzibar to Dar es Salaam by Sea &#8211; Hydrofoil Boats: 90 minutes.</p>

<p>DOMESTIC AND INTERNAL FLIGHTS:<br />
Air Tanzania, Precision Air, Eagle Air, Zan Air, Coastal Air, Regional Air run scheduled from between Dar es Salaam, Zanzibar, Arusha and to the various Regional airports and National Park airstrips.</p>
